Understanding Obesity and the Role of Testing
Obesity is a complex medical condition characterised by excessive accumulation of body fat that can negatively affect your overall health. Different types of obesity exist, including central obesity (excess fat around the abdomen), generalized obesity (excess fat distributed throughout the body), and metabolically healthy obesity (where an individual has a high BMI but no associated metabolic complications).
Obesity is not merely a cosmetic concern or the result of lifestyle choices alone, it often involves underlying hormonal, genetic, metabolic, or psychological factors. Left unaddressed, obesity can significantly increase the risk of developing chronic conditions such as type 2 diabetes, heart disease, fatty liver, and certain cancers.
Beyond physical health, obesity is also deeply linked to emotional well-being. Individuals living with obesity often face social stigma, discrimination, and lowered self-esteem, which can further contribute to anxiety, depression, and social isolation. This stigma can also deter people from seeking timely medical help or testing.

Obesity testing plays a crucial role in:
- Early detection of related health conditions: Obesity testing can uncover warning signs of diabetes, thyroid imbalance, or liver dysfunction.
- Monitoring metabolic and hormonal health: Tests help track insulin levels, cortisol, leptin, and other hormones that affect body weight.
- Prevention of chronic diseases: Timely obesity screening tests can reduce the risk of conditions like heart disease, PCOS, and sleep apnoea.
- Personalised weight management: Testing offers insights that allow doctors and dieticians to tailor lifestyle and treatment plans.

Physical Assessments:
- Body Mass Index (BMI): Measures your body fat based on height and weight, helping determine if you fall into the underweight, normal, overweight, or obese category.
- Waist-to-Hip Ratio: Evaluates fat distribution, which can indicate cardiovascular risk.
- Body Fat Percentage: A precise indicator of total fat mass in your body, giving more clarity than BMI alone.

Conditions That Can Be Diagnosed with Obesity Tests
An obesity diagnosis test can help identify or manage a range of obesity-related medical conditions, including:
- Type 2 Diabetes and Insulin Resistance: Regular blood sugar testing helps detect diabetes early and monitor insulin sensitivity.
- PCOS and Female Infertility: Hormonal imbalance due to obesity may cause reproductive health challenges in women.
- Cardiovascular Diseases: High cholesterol and blood pressure are often tied to obesity.
- Fatty Liver Disease: Excess fat in the liver can impair function and escalate to liver failure if untreated.
- Sleep Apnoea: Obesity increases the risk of airway obstruction during sleep, leading to fatigue and low oxygen levels.
Symptoms That May Require an Obesity Test
Recognising signs early is vital. The following symptoms may indicate the need for a diagnostic obesity test in Noida:
- Joint Pain: Extra weight can strain joints, leading to discomfort and stiffness.
- High Blood Pressure: Often coexists with obesity and may need regular monitoring.
- Insulin Resistance: Can present as cravings, fatigue, or difficulty losing weight.
- Fatigue: A common symptom caused by inflammation, hormonal imbalance, or blood sugar issues.
- Breathlessness: Increased fat around the chest or abdomen can impact lung capacity.
- Sleep Disorders: Snoring or insomnia may be linked to obesity and require testing.
- Mood Swings and Low Energy: May be driven by cortisol or thyroid hormone imbalance.
- Irregular Periods: In women, obesity-related hormonal disruptions can alter menstrual cycles.

How to Prepare for an Obesity Test?
Preparation ensures more accurate readings and a smoother process.
- Fast for 8–12 hours before blood sugar and lipid profile tests.
- Avoid alcohol or caffeine 24 hours prior to sample collection.
- Inform the technician about any medications you are taking.
- Stay hydrated to make blood collection easier.
